#shopify-section-custom-video-with-icons .custom-video-with-icons,.custom-video-with-icons{box-sizing:border-box}#shopify-section-custom-video-with-icons .custom-video-with-icons *,#shopify-section-custom-video-with-icons .custom-video-with-icons *:before,#shopify-section-custom-video-with-icons .custom-video-with-icons *:after,.custom-video-with-icons *,.custom-video-with-icons *:before,.custom-video-with-icons *:after{box-sizing:inherit}#shopify-section-custom-video-with-icons .custom-video-with-icons__container,.custom-video-with-icons__container{display:flex;flex-direction:column;gap:32px;width:100%;max-width:100%}#shopify-section-custom-video-with-icons .custom-video-with-icons__video-wrapper,.custom-video-with-icons__video-wrapper{width:100%}.custom-video-with-icons__poster{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over;object-position:center}.custom-video-with-icons__video-wrapper.has-video-fallback video-media[data-fallback-active] video,.custom-video-with-icons__video-wrapper.has-video-fallback video-media[data-saver-mode] video{opacity:0!important;visibility:hidden!important;pointer-events:none}.custom-video-with-icons__video-wrapper.has-video-fallback video-media[data-fallback-active] img,.custom-video-with-icons__video-wrapper.has-video-fallback video-media[data-saver-mode] img{opacity:1!important;visibility:visible!important}.video-play-button--fallback-only{opacity:0;visibility:hidden;pointer-events:none}.custom-video-with-icons__video-wrapper.has-video-fallback .video-play-button{opacity:1;visibility:visible;pointer-events:auto;z-index:2}.custom-video-with-icons__video-wrapper.has-video-fallback .place-self-center,.custom-video-with-icons__video-wrapper.has-video-fallback .place-self-center *{pointer-events:auto}#shopify-section-custom-video-with-icons .custom-video-with-icons__grid,.custom-video-with-icons__grid{list-style:none;margin:0;padding:0;display:grid;grid-template-columns:repeat(2,1fr);gap:16px;width:100%}#shopify-section-custom-video-with-icons .custom-video-with-icons__item,.custom-video-with-icons__item{display:flex;flex-direction:column;align-items:center;gap:8px;text-align:center;padding:16px;background-color:var(--item-background-color, #F5F5F5);border-radius:var(--rounded-lg)}#shopify-section-custom-video-with-icons .custom-video-with-icons__icon,.custom-video-with-icons__icon{display:flex;align-items:center;justify-content:center;width:24px;height:24px;color:var(--icon-color, currentColor);flex-shrink:0}#shopify-section-custom-video-with-icons .custom-video-with-icons__icon svg,.custom-video-with-icons__icon svg{width:24px;height:24px;display:block}#shopify-section-custom-video-with-icons .custom-video-with-icons__custom-icon,.custom-video-with-icons__custom-icon{width:24px;height:24px;object-fit:contain}#shopify-section-custom-video-with-icons .custom-video-with-icons__content,.custom-video-with-icons__content{display:flex;flex-direction:column;gap:4px;padding:0;width:100%}#shopify-section-custom-video-with-icons .custom-video-with-icons__item-title,.custom-video-with-icons__item-title{margin:0;font-family:DM Sans,sans-serif;font-size:14px;font-weight:700;line-height:1.3;color:inherit}#shopify-section-custom-video-with-icons .custom-video-with-icons__item-description,.custom-video-with-icons__item-description{margin:0;font-family:DM Sans,sans-serif;font-size:14px;font-weight:300;line-height:1.4;color:inherit}@media (min-width: 1000px){#shopify-section-custom-video-with-icons .custom-video-with-icons__container,.custom-video-with-icons__container{gap:40px}#shopify-section-custom-video-with-icons .custom-video-with-icons__grid,.custom-video-with-icons__grid{grid-template-columns:repeat(var(--icon-count, 4),1fr);max-width:100%;gap:24px}#shopify-section-custom-video-with-icons .custom-video-with-icons__grid--single,.custom-video-with-icons__grid--single{grid-template-columns:1fr;max-width:300px;margin-left:auto;margin-right:auto}#shopify-section-custom-video-with-icons .custom-video-with-icons__grid--double,.custom-video-with-icons__grid--double{grid-template-columns:repeat(2,1fr);max-width:500px;margin-left:auto;margin-right:auto}#shopify-section-custom-video-with-icons .custom-video-with-icons__grid--triple,.custom-video-with-icons__grid--triple{grid-template-columns:repeat(3,1fr);max-width:700px;margin-left:auto;margin-right:auto}#shopify-section-custom-video-with-icons .custom-video-with-icons__grid--quad,.custom-video-with-icons__grid--quad{grid-template-columns:repeat(4,1fr);max-width:100%}#shopify-section-custom-video-with-icons .custom-video-with-icons__item,.custom-video-with-icons__item{gap:12px}#shopify-section-custom-video-with-icons .custom-video-with-icons__icon,.custom-video-with-icons__icon{width:32px;height:32px}#shopify-section-custom-video-with-icons .custom-video-with-icons__icon svg,.custom-video-with-icons__icon svg{width:32px;height:32px}#shopify-section-custom-video-with-icons .custom-video-with-icons__custom-icon,.custom-video-with-icons__custom-icon{width:32px;height:32px}#shopify-section-custom-video-with-icons .custom-video-with-icons__item-title,.custom-video-with-icons__item-title{font-size:18px}#shopify-section-custom-video-with-icons .custom-video-with-icons__item-description,.custom-video-with-icons__item-description{font-size:16px}}
/*# sourceMappingURL=/cdn/shop/t/96/assets/custom-video-with-icons.css.map */
